Sensex gains 74 points
MUMBAI: With eyes set on 15000-mark, bulls on Wednesday continued their record-run on the bourses for third day in a row with the benchmark Sensex settling at a new peak of 14880.24 on strong buying in auto, cement and metal stocks.
The Bombay Stock Exchange’s 30-share index closed with a gain of 73.73 points after crossing the 14900-mark for the first time ever to reach an intra-day peak of 14906.93 earlier in the day.
Besides, expectations for good first quarter results, positive global cues and falling inflation levels are also adding to the positive sentiments, brokers said. — PTI
